DRIVE OS Linux File Systems

The following table shows the Debian package to be installed for the specified file system.

File System File to Download Purpose
driveos-oobe-ubuntu-20.04-rfs nv-driveos-linux-driveos-oobe-ubuntu-20.04-rfs-<release>-<DRIVEOS_GCID>_<release>-<DRIVEOS_GCID>_amd64.deb

Intended to be used by developers as a development or reference filesystem.

Contains NVIDIA automotive sample applications and corresponding documentations.

driveos-oobe-desktop-ubuntu-20.04-rfs nv-driveos-linux-driveos-oobe-desktop-ubuntu-20.04-rfs-<release>-<DRIVEOS_GCID>_<release>-<DRIVEOS_GCID>_amd64.deb

Intended to be used by developers as a development or reference filesystem.

Contains NVIDIA automotive GUI desktop interface, sample applications, and corresponding documentations.

driveos-core-ubuntu-20.04-rfs nv-driveos-linux-driveos-core-ubuntu-20.04-rfs-<release>-<DRIVEOS_GCID>_<release>-<DRIVEOS_GCID>_amd64.deb

Intended to be used by production systems.

Contains NVIDIA automotive drivers, libraries, tools, firmware, scripts, and other required files for core functionality.

Where <DRIVEOS_GCID> is the GCID of NVIDIA DRIVE® OS Linux and <release> is the NVIDIA DRIVE® OS Linux SDK version.

Note:
  • The DRIVE OS Linux file system Debian is installable only in the local Debian installer workflow. The steps for the local Debian installer are in the Install DRIVE OS Linux Debian Packages topic.
